Description
Is the Romantic longing for what is infinite to be found in 'E.T.'? Does it make sense to talk about the 'late Romantic style' in 'Star Wars'? Does 'Raiders of the Lost Ark' distance itself aesthetically from Richard Wagner?
This study addresses the link between the film music of John Williams and the epochal phenomena that occurred around 1800. It questions an expansive concept of Romanticism for film music and determines aesthetic expressions of the desire for transcendence as a guiding motif in Romantic art. It takes the double meaning of the word 'leitmotiv' into account, thus adopting two perspectives: the motivation of Romantic art on the one hand and the technical term for musical narrative composition on the other.
